Recruitment / Callot
Potential raw recruits are given the once over before they take the Kings shilling. Experienced troops on parade look dashing to encourage & lure those in two-minds

The Thirty Years' War was a brutal and protracted conflict that raged across Europe, and the demand for soldiers was insatiable. Recruitment drives like this one were a common sight, as armies sought to bolster their ranks with fresh, young recruits. The promise of adventure, camaraderie, and the opportunity to defend one's country were powerful incentives, even if the reality of war was often far removed from the romanticized notions held by the recruits.
